Dawn (Al-Fajr)
In the name of Allah, the Compassionate, the Merciful
By the Dawn 1 by the Ten Nights, 2 And by the even and the odd, 3 And by the night when it departeth, 4 Is there in this an oath for one endowed with understanding? 5 Have you not considered how your Lord dealt with Ad, 6 the people of Iram, the city of many pillars, 7 The like of which were not created in the (other) cities; 8 And with Thamud who carved rocks in the valley; 9 And (with) Fir'aun (Pharaoh), who had pegs (who used to torture men by binding them to pegs)? 10 Who terrorised the region, 11 And multiplied therein corruption. 12 so your Lord unleashed on them the scourge of punishment: 13 Truly your Lord is ever watchful. 14 As for man, when his Lord tries him by giving him honour and gifts, then he says (puffed up): "My Lord has honoured me." 15 but when He tests him by straitening his means of livelihood, he says, "My Lord has disgraced me." 16 Nay! but you do not honor the orphan, 17 And urge not on the feeding of AlMiskin (the poor)! 18 and you devour the inheritance greedily, 19 And love wealth with abounding love. 20 Nay! When the earth is ground to powder, 21 And your Lord comes with the angels in rows, 22 and when Hell is brought near that Day. On that Day will man understand, but of what avail will that understanding be? 23 He will say, "Oh, I wish I had sent ahead [some good] for my life." 24 Upon that day none shall chastise as He chastises, 25 None bindeth as He then will bind. 26 (On the other hand it will be said): “O serene soul! 27 return to your Lord well pleased with him and He will be pleased with you. 28 Enter among My servants 29 And enter thou My Garden. 30
